研究方向

1. 微流控单细胞操控与质谱分析;2. 手性分离与分析方法。

主要研究成果

围绕微流控单细胞分析与手性分离分析开展研究。面向单细胞化学信息的高时空分辨获取需求,构建了开放式微流控探头及微流控–质谱联用方法体系,实现了单细胞局部刺激、亚细胞成分取样、细胞膜损伤与修复行为表征以及行为–分子组成关联分析。同时,开展手性分离介质与分析方法研究。以第一作者或通讯作者身份在 Chem. Rev.、Chem. Soc. Rev.、Angew. Chem. Int. Ed.、Chem. Sci.、Anal. Chem. 等期刊发表论文15篇。主持国家自然科学基金青年科学基金项目(C类)和中国博士后科学基金面上资助项目各1项,获授权中国发明专利3项。

主持科研项目

1. 国家自然科学基金青年科学基金项目(C类)(原青年科学基金项目),“同一单细胞行为及组分检测的微流控–质谱分析方法研究与应用”,2025—2027,主持,在研。

2. 中国博士后科学基金面上资助项目,“开放式微流控双水相流体聚焦用于原位亚细胞化学损伤及修复再生行为研究”,2022—2024,主持,结题。
